recent stops on eastbound leg
I drove from SoCal to MD. Some pics I took on Comanche trail, Palo Dura Canyon, TX, then Slaughterhouse Trails in Bentonville, AR (only took one pic, was having too much fun just going along. Next was Glade Runner at St James MO, super fun flowing trail through the woods with some more techy rocky side routes near the creek/river area. Finally Scales Lake in Boonville IN--just a pure fun roller coaster through the woods, lots of little down/ups and tight turns. I also rode at Morgantown WV, but took no pics.

and west bound
stopped at Capitol View State Park in Frankfort KY--great fun; well kept trail network near the river.
Then back to Scales Lake Then Creve Coeur Park just west of St Louis--nice flowing trail through the woods. LARGE aerial course there too ailed to ride in DeSoto KS due to a huge cross country meet, so on to Lake Wilson where I just had time before sunset to do the Marina Loop--very fun, I did it reverse of mtbproject so had some tough step-ups but it was very manageable. DEfinitely worth the stop if you are on I-70 From there I did a big drive to Western CO, so I could knock out 2 epic rides my last day: AM ride at Fruita 18 road area--such great trails. I had so much fun I didn't stop much for pics--only one was my least favorite--zippity do dah. A one-note type of trail up and down the ridge line, which for me just tested my guts/confidence for screaming VERY fast almost straight down a line into wash-board-rattling brutality and then up again. All the other trails were so much more fun--I had one section of the frontside trail after western zippity trail that I'd not clear on my best day, and had to hike a bike that section. From Fruita I drove to LaVerkin UT for afternoon ride on JEM, Goosebumps, Cryptobiotic, back up cryptobiotic to JEM, and back around to the truck. Most fun for me was Fruita and JEM area trails--nothing like 2-3 mile swooping, curving, dropping, rolling awesomeness Most smiles with no pucker factor at all for me was St James MO and Scales Lake, IN, but I do love winding through forests--both offer about 7 mile loops with some additional options, and the main risk is just going too fast for some of the unexpected corners. Bentonville was great too, but I'd need more time there to get familiar with routes and best directions to link things--it also goes in and out of a pretty popular park and residential area, and I prefer the more wilderness feel. But the trails are well maintained and very fun. Last edited by jimcav; 10-02-2020 at 09:33 PM. |
